Applied Behavior Analysis Technician (ABAT)
The ABAT credential certifies that candidates have demonstrated entry-level (ABAT) knowledge, skill, and their competency in autism and applied behavior analysis (ABA) has been thoroughly assessed. An ABAT is a paraprofessional in behavior analysis who practices under the close, ongoing Supervision of a BCBA/QBA or BCaBA/QASP-S.This course is equivalent to the RBT certification offered by the BACB.
Course Details
  • Total Hours - 40 Hours
  • Course Duration - 4 Months
  • Mode of classes - Online

CRIA Coursework Requirements
  • Candidate must be at least 18 years old.
  • Must have completed 10+2 years of education from a National / Recognised State Board.
Additional Requirements
(The student can make their own arrangements or request CRIA for support to complete these requirements.)
  • Fieldwork Hours - 15 Hours
  • Supervision Hours - 10% of Independent Fieldwork Hours (1.5 Hours)
Fieldwork and/or Supervision can be provided by CRIA on a case-by-case basis as per availability. Please refer to the ABAT Candidate Handbook for detailed guidelines.
Qualified Autism Services Practioner-Supervisor (QASP-S)
The QASP-S credential certifies that candidates have demonstrated mid-level (QASP-S) knowledge, skill, and their competency in autism and Applied Behavior Analysis has been thoroughly assessed. The mid level QASP-S provides behavioral health services under the supervision of a QBA or above behavior analyst or a licensed or certified professional within the scope of Applied Behavior Analysis.This course is equivalent to the BCaBA certification offered by the BACB.
Course Details
  • Total Hours - 180 Hours
  • Course Duration - 14 Months
  • Mode of classes - Online

CRIA Coursework Requirements
  • Candidate must be at least 18 years old.
  • Must have completed a minimum of a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ution.
Additional Requirements
(Students appearing for the exam can make their own arrangements for these requirements or request CRIA for support.)
  • Fieldwork Hours - 1000 Hours
  • Supervision Hours - 5% of Independent Fieldwork Hours (50 hours)
  • Supervisory coursework - 8 Hours

Qualified Behaviour Analyst (QBA)
The QBA credential certifies that candidates have demonstrated master's-level achievement in applied behavior analysis or a related health service profession, advanced applied skills through supervised fieldwork experience, professional integrity and decision-making maturity through supervisor recommendation, and competency in subject matter including autism and ABA and ethical/legal standards have been assessed through written examination.This course is equivalent to the BCBA certification offered by the BACB.
Course Details
  • Total Hours - 270 Hours
  • Course Duration - 18 Months
  • Mode of classes - Online

CRIA Coursework Requirements
  • Candidate must be at least 18 years old.
  • Must have completed a minimum of a Masters degree from an accredited institution.
  • Mode of classes - Online
Additional Requirements
(Students appearing for the exam can make their own arrangements for these requirements or request CRIA for support )
  • Fieldwork hours - 1500 Hours
  • Supervision Hours - 5% of Independent Fieldwork (75 Hours)
